DESCRIPTION
Picco Ivigna and its forerunner, the Piccolo Picco Ivigna, are two very panoramic peaks of the Sarentine Alps.
The two peaks are located in a beautiful panoramic position, where they dominate the city of Merano. From the peaks you have a splendid view: your gaze is drawn to the Ortles and Adamello, the Brenta Dolomites, the Sas de Pütia, the Marmolada, the Catinaccio, the Latemar, the Gruppo di Tessa, the Venoste and Breonie Alps. In short, you are on an exceptional panoramic balcony!
The Piccolo Picco Ivigna is within everyone's reach, while to go up to Picco Ivigna you have to overcome a short aided and exposed stretch, so it is not for everyone!
ITINERARY
From the Falzeben car park (1614 m) take trail no. 14 which quickly leads to the Rifugio Zuegg (1760 m). Always continue on the 14, pass near the ski lifts of Merano 2000, and then following the 3 and 19, you arrive at the Rifugio Kuhleiten (2361 m). Now go back a little and take the path that leads to Picco Ivigna. Going up you arrive at a crossroads: you can go straight to the Piccolo Picco Ivigna / Kleiner Ifinger (2552 m), or - making a stretch of via ferrata - you get to Picco Ivigna / Ifinger (2581 m). Return to the Rifugio Kuhleiten and descend from path 19A passing the small church of Sant Osvaldo (2185 m) and arriving in Merano 2000. Here you return to the parking lot along the same road.

AUTHOR’S SUGGESTIONS
Those who do not want to take the short stretch of via ferrata to Picco Ivigna can easily go up to the Piccolo Picco Ivigna only.

HOW TO ARRIVE
From Bolzano SS38 MEBO to Sinigo. Here you take the SP17 to the right, then the SP8 and finally the SP98 up to Avelengo / Hafling. Continue following the signs for Falzeben.
